Landscaping costs depend on the specific needs of your property. Factors include the total square footage, the complexity of the design, and the types of materials—like stone versus mulch—you choose. If your yard requires grading, drainage improvements, or clearing out heavy debris, that adds labor time. Large landscaping rocks serve as decorative elements or functional barriers within a garden design. They are used to create depth, provide natural seating, or act as a foundation for water features. You would typically incorporate these when you want to break up flat areas of your yard or add a permanent, low-maintenance feature. Choosing the right landscape edging in New Haven is key to a tidy and defined yard. Many licensed pros can install durable materials like stone or metal that complement your home's style and withstand the local climate. Proper edging helps keep mulch in place and prevents grass from creeping into garden beds, maintaining a neat appearance. It's a simple yet effective way to boost your curb appeal.
